Memorial Day Memory
My father's Army unit in WWII. Not sure whether they had arrived in Europe or were still in the US. My father is top row center, the tallest man in the unit. Ahead of them was the Battle of the Bulge and a freezing cold winter. My father came home but was not the man who went to war at 23.
